A seller's market
Just 5 homes for sale against 64 sales a year, roughly 0.9 months of supply, firmly a seller's market.
Timing matters
August is the window: homes listed then go under contract in under two weeks, while April listings have taken about two months.
Values climbing
The median sale price is up about 10.2% year over year, so equity has been building for owners here.
How fast do homes sell in Northlake?
Over the past year, homes in Northlake have gone under contract in about three weeks on average (22 days), with the typical home closing in about 10 days.
What is my Northlake home worth?
Homes here have sold for a median of $318,750 over the last 12 months, around $236 per square foot. Every home is different, so request a free, no-obligation valuation for a figure specific to yours.
Is now a good time to sell in Northlake?
With 5 homes for sale against 64 sales a year, about 0.9 months of supply, Northlake is a seller's market. Sellers here have been getting about 100.8% of list price.
